Q: Is 536,042 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 536,042 is not a prime number.

Why is 536,042 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 536042 can be evenly divided by 1 2 13 26 53 106 389 689 778 1,378 5,057 10,114 20,617 41,234 268,021 and 536,042, with no remainder.

Since 536,042 cannot be divided by just 1 and 536,042, it is not a prime number.
